[Job-24874] Senior Java Developer , Brazil
Brazil
GU6 – Prod_GU6 /
Homeoffice /
Remote
Somos especialistas em transformação tecnológica, unindo expertise humana à IA para criar soluções tech escaláveis. Com mais de 7.400 CI&Ters ao redor do mundo, já formamos parcerias com mais de 1.000 clientes durante nossos 30 anos de história. Inteligência Artificial é nossa realidade.
Importante: se você reside na Região Metropolitana de Campinas, sua presença nos escritórios da cidade será obrigatória, conforme a política de frequencia vigente.
Buscamos pessoas localizadas no Brasil para trabalhar como Mid Level Java developer, e atuar em um projeto com a oportunidade de modernizar sistemas em uma das maiores empresas de telecomunicações do Brasil.
RESPONSABILIDADES:
Inteligência Artificial: Responsável por projetar, desenvolver e implementar agentes de inteligência artificial que atendam às necessidades de nossos clientes e avaliar os resultados produzidos por ela;
Excelência na Entrega de Software: Aplicar e evangelizar as melhores práticas de desenvolvimento e operação para garantir a entrega contínua de código de alta qualidade, minimizando as taxas de defeitos e otimizando a performance dos sistemas.
Autonomia e Liderança Técnica: Atuar com autonomia em suas atividades, tomando decisões técnicas embasadas e propondo soluções inovadoras. Além disso, você terá um papel crucial no apoio e mentoria de outros membros da equipe, promovendo a disseminação do conhecimento e o crescimento coletivo.
REQUISITOS TÉCNICOS:
Proficiência em Java: Domínio da linguagem de programação Java, incluindo suas melhores práticas, design patterns e ecossistema de ferramentas.
Engenharia de Prompt: Experiência prática e comprovada em engenharia de prompt, com a capacidade de projetar e otimizar interações com modelos de linguagem para obter resultados precisos e eficientes.
Aceleração com GenIA: Habilidade e experiência no uso de Inteligência Artificial Generativa (GenIA) para acelerar diversas atividades do ciclo de desenvolvimento, desde a geração de código até a análise de dados e otimização de processos.
Automação de Processos: Habilidade em implementar scripts de automação de processos de desenvolvimento utilizando linguagens Python, Shell Script ou outras.
Automação de Testes: Experiência em desenvolvimento em diversas camadas da pirâmide de testes.
Familiaridade com práticas de desenvolvimento ágil e controle de versão (Git)
DIFERENCIAIS:
Conhecimento em Spring Boot: Conhecimento do framework Spring Boot.
Conhecimento em Bancos de Dados: Experiência com bancos de dados relacionais, especialmente Postgres, e com bancos de dados NoSQL, como MongoDB e Redis, incluindo modelagem, otimização de consultas e administração básica.
Interações Assíncronas e Event-Driven: Experiência em projetar e implementar sistemas baseados em interações assíncronas, arquiteturas orientadas a eventos e uso de filas de mensagens (e.g., Kafka, RabbitMQ).
Diagnóstico de Problemas Complexos: Habilidade no diagnóstico e resolução de problemas complexos em sistemas distribuídos, utilizando ferramentas de observabilidade, logs e métricas.
Versionamento de APIs RESTful: Experiência na concepção, desenvolvimento e versionamento de APIs RESTful, seguindo as melhores práticas para garantir escalabilidade, segurança e usabilidade.
Ferramentas de Produtividade: Experiência com Jira Software e Confluence.
#LI-PA1
Nossos benefícios:
- Plano de saúde e odontológico;
- Vale alimentação e refeição;
- Auxílio-creche;
- Licença parental estendida;
- Parceria com academias e profissionais de saúde e bem-estar via Wellhub (Gympass) TotalPass;
- Participação nos Lucros e Resultados (PLR);
- Seguro de Vida;
- Plataforma de aprendizagem contínua (CI&T University);
- Clube de descontos;
- Plataforma online gratuita dedicada à promoção da saúde física, mental e bem-estar;
- Curso gestante e parentalidade responsável;
- Parceria com plataformas de cursos online;
- Plataforma para aprendizagem de idiomas;
- E muitos outros
Mais detalhes sobre os nossos benefícios aqui: https://ciandt.com/br/pt-br/carreiras
Na CI&T, a inclusão começa no primeiro contato. Se você é pessoa com deficiência, é importante apresentar o seu laudo durante o processo seletivo. Assim, podemos garantir o suporte e as adaptações que você merece. Se ainda não tem o laudo caracterizador, não se preocupe: podemos te apoiar para obtê-lo.
Temos um time dedicado de Saúde e Bem-estar, especialistas em inclusão e grupos de afinidade que estarão com você em todas as etapas. Conte com a gente para fazer essa jornada lado a lado.
We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.